CFPUA Launches New GenX Timeline to Website

Since June 2017, CFPUA has been providing regular updates to the community on the issue of emerging contaminants. These updates have remained on our website, and they give a detailed history of the issue and CFPUA action to address water quality concerns.

To provide a summary of these updates for visitors to our site, we have created a new timeline. Visitors to the page may scroll through and watch news clips, read documents and learn more about the issue of emerging contaminants in the Cape Fear River.

Staff will continue to update the timeline as our work on this issue progresses.

New GenX Results From the Sweeney Water Treatment Plant

We have received results for April 3 from our on-going GenX testing at the Sweeney Water Treatment Plant. Levels of GenX continue to remain below the DHHS health goal of 140 parts per trillion (ppt)."sweeney.4_18JPG"
